History, Experience & Leadership Counts!
I have nominated to represent the Port Adelaide area as a true Independent,
I served the local community for 12 years as Mayor of Port Adelaide Enfield.
My great-grandfather, William Bevan, arrived in Port Adelaide from Tasmania in 1845 and became a shunter. On his passing in 1904 the members from the Adelaide Working Men's Assoc, the precursor of the Maritime Union were called to follow the remains of their late brother to the Woodville Cemetary.
My Grandfather, Frederick Johanson, signed off in Port Lincoln in 1910 a Swedish sailor, an early Union Member, he settled in Port Adelaide, marrying my Grandmother in a Manse in Alberton in 1911. He passed away in the 1940's.
My Grandmother later remarried to Captain Walter (Wally) Todd, born 1883, and they lived in Deslandes St. Ethelton until 1974. He was a Master Mariner and a legend with the union movement.
My wife Vicky’s family still live in the family home in Blair Athol, where her parents settled from Europe after WWII.
I attended Seaton Boys Technical High School and have been associated with the Port all my life.

My strong connection to Defence includes membership of the RSL. My Grandfather on my mother's side,
a Port Adelaide local, volunteered in WW1, he fought in the fiercest battles and
was injured many times. My father volunteered for the Army in WW2
and trained in Jungle Warfare in QLD. I was a long-time volunteer for the
Defence Reserves Support Council of SA until the government disbanded it.
During my time assisting the board I sailed out of Port Adelaide overnight on the HMAS voyage
of the Tobruk, I also went to the Solomon Islands with Defence to see the Reserves in their
peace keeping role as well as flying to Woomera with the Air Force to inspect facilities there.
I wrote to the Prime Minister to get Navy ships to re-visit the Port after it was being by- passed.
Just before leaving my Mayoral role I managed to get a friends fathers WW2 flying uniform, equipment and flight logs donated to the War Museum in Canberra, includimg his DFC medal that he received for
Reconnaissance over Normandy.
Also while Mayor I proposed that all councils in Australia should include in their workplace
agreements protection for the jobs of workers who are on Reserve duties or deployment,
This proposal was accepted by all councils in Australia as a result .
